A twice-daily podcast from the Marcus Today team for self-directed investors. Published every weekday before the ASX open and after the close (AEST), these short updates cover what's moving markets, key developments overnight, and the themes shaping the trading day. Clear. Practical. No noise.

End of Day Report - Fri 17 Dec 17.12.2021

The ASX 200 rose just 8 points to 7304 as enthusiasm waned into the weekend, big sell off in the last hour or so. Banks and miners driving the gains as tech crumbled. The Big Bank Basket rose to $176.11 (1.5%) with CBA up 2.4% and ANZ rallying 0.7%. End of Day Report - Thu 16 Dec 16.12.2021

The ASX 200 fell 31 points ' CSL adjusted' today to 7296 (0.4%). CSL accounted for 34 negative points after falling 8.2% to issue price as huge capital raising weighs. SPI expiry bumps volume. Over $1bn worth of trade in CSL . Suspect instos selling to retail. Breakfast Briefing - Thu 16 Dec 15.12.2021

Dow up 383, rallying post the Fed announcement. Whilst the central bank announced an even faster taper than the market expected, and that it will raise rates more aggressively, the market took it in its stride. End of Day Report - Tue14 Dec 14.12.2021

The ASX 200 claws its way back into positive territory briefly but closed down 1 point to 7378. Early broad -based losses not helped by negative US leads and compounded by WOW news. Both WOW and COL down substantially with 14 index points knocked off on these two alone. WOW dropped 7.7%, COL down 2.7% as Covid came to town. End of Day Report - Tue 7 Dec 07.12.2021

 The ASX 200 rose 69 points to 7314 (0.95%) after the RBA keeps rates unchanged and turns a little cautious dropping reference to a date for conditions to allow rate change. The market rallied strongly on the news. Banks kicked higher with the Big Bank Basket up to $174.38 (0.8%) with BOQ doing well post an update, up 4.2%.
